Latest in best selling Reuters photography book series.

Caption|REUTERS/Suzanne PlunkettMillions of people see the world through the eyes of our photographers every day; a collective vision of events shaped by the split second the photographer chose to record.

Our World Now 5 draws on this extraordinary resource, encompassing the diversity of stories, trends and moods that defined 2011. Featuring images by 144 photographers of 56 nationalities, the fifth volume in this collector’s series offers dramatic breaking news, in-depth photo essays, photographer profiles and moments of pure visual delight.

Ayperi Karabuda Ecer, vice president of Reuters Pictures and picture editor of the series said: "The Our World Now photography book series has become a collector’s item, selling over 100,000 copies worldwide. This success points to the unparalleled global impact of photography, and to our mission at Reuters of journalistic excellence. In Our World Now 5 we meet the faces of change, hope and despair. We combine key world moments with intimate details, forming a multi-layered story that very few have the privilege to tell.”

Our World Now 5 is published in English and French and now available internationally.
